Forum Discussion

Anonymous's avatar
Anonymous
10 years ago
Approved

Re: unable to play bf4/bf3 with black bars

I see.  This is the settings page you changing it from?  GPU Scaling Maintain Aspect?

If that's what you are trying.. perhaps try disabling Scaling and just set the game to 800x600 Fullscreen in the settings.

Most people have the opposite problem and I believe by default Scaling is not on at all.

*edit*

I did more googling and it seems this has been brought up before for both BF3/4 for people.  The game sometimes seems to override the scaling options set by the GPU software.

One guy suggested to edit your  PROF_SAVE_profile with Notepad (Documents folder)
GstRender.ResolutionHertz 0

Another idea I had was... set it to Windowed mode but use software to Lock the cursor it to the window so it doesn't jump off.

I use this software to lock to certain monitors for some games that refuse to lock it themselves:

http://dualmonitortool.sourceforge.net/swapscreen.html

I think it can do lock to Window too but I haven't test and I can't right at the minute.

*edit2*

After reviewing the settings for those tools.. I don't think those can do it but this software looks like it can.  I haven't personally tested it.

http://www.snakebytestudios.com/projects/apps/cursor-lock/

13 Replies

  • if i disable scaling it will be centered and whole picture is inside black square

  • even if i put the monitor on 800x600 and with black bars, still the game goes to streched

  • i dont think how cursor lock is going to help me, i still cant get black bars

  • bf3 and bf4 are the only games that do that, csgo is fine and works witch current settings and black bars

  • Anonymous's avatar
    Anonymous
    10 years ago
    Approved

    mmm...

    What does it do when you do this:

    Enable the Maintain Aspect Ratio again.

    Change the Resolution of Windows to 800x600.

    Do Black Bars show up (in windows desktop) or does it stretch to fit the monitor?

    If it has the black bars, try to put BF4 in Borderless mode.

    Only thing I've come up with so far.

    *edit*

    I think this is borderless in BF4  ini file

    GstRender.FullscreenEnabled 0
    GstRender.FullscreenMode 2
    GstRender.FullscreenScreen 0

  • NOTE THAT EVERY OTHER GAME and WINDOWS res is WITH black bars , but with these setting that i get balck bars in csgo and other games , bf doesnt want to do that, yes i have 2bars @800x600 on win res, yes borderless did the job but i dont want to change the monitor res every damn time :C

  • Anonymous's avatar
    Anonymous
    10 years ago
    Approved

    I understand.  It appears BF3/4 have an issue with GPU Drivers Maintain Aspect settings (both AMD and nVidia) from what I saw searching around.

    Glad it works.  Sorry it's a pain in the rear end but that may be the only way to achieve what you need ☹️

  • if i have full res, and preserve aspect ratio, i click on the game, note that its on 1024x768 4:3 . it imideatly goes to stretched and radeon settings goes to full panel

  • it works but its 60hz, and dod , thats why i play on low ees to achieven 150+ fps. its not a solutin accualy, its something to do with the game

  • if i take gpu scaling off, and go into the game, put 720p res, it looks like 4:3 but stretched upwards with black bars, and if i go to 1024x768 it is full panel and streched, i need help from devs :C